  • the present invention relates to the technical field of boxes, especially a safety box capable of preventing opening by an infant and an opening method.
  • Boxes are used to store various kinds of objects in daily life, such as food, medicine and so on.
  • Cipheral patent discloses a self-locking anti-shedding pull-out type gift packaging box, which includes an inner box and an outer box. Both side edges of the outer box are provided with transverse sliding grooves, the front end of the transverse sliding groove is provided with an anti-shedding stopper, the rear end of the transverse sliding groove is provided with a clamping hole, the rear part of the inner box is connected with a "U" shaped elastic sheet, the rear part of the inner box is provided with a longitudinal sliding groove, the U-shaped elastic sheet is provided with a sliding rod matched with the longitudinal sliding groove, the two ends of the "U" shaped elastic sheet are symmetrically provided with clamping balls matched with the transverse sliding grooves, and the clamping balls can be slidably clamped into the clamping holes.
  • This packaging box has the advantage of preventing shedding.
  • the structure of this packaging box is complex and inconvenient to open. At the same time, infants can still open it.
  • the purpose of the present invention is to provide a safety box capable of preventing opening by an infant and an opening method to solve the above-mentioned problems.

  • the safety box capable of preventing opening by an infant in the present invention includes: A paper pulp outer box 1 which is rectangular, and an inner box inlet and outlet opening 10 provided in one end of the paper pulp outer box 1.
  • the paper pulp outer box 1 is made of paper plant fiber material.
  • the paper pulp outer box is environmentally friendly and degradable.
  • buckle holes are arranged on the two sides of the paper pulp outer box 1 respectively; and the buckle holes (11) are square holes.
  • a paper pulp inner box 2 which is made of paper plant fiber material.
  • the paper pulp inner box is environmentally friendly and degradable.
  • the paper pulp inner box 2 enters the paper pulp outer box 1 through the inner box inlet and outlet opening 10, so that outwardly protruding buckles 20 one by one become buckled through the buckle holes 11 on the two side edges of the paper pulp outer box 1 respectively, and the wall thickness of the outwardly protruding buckles 20 is equal to that of the paper pulp inner box 2.
  • Equal wall thickness can facilitate processing and manufacturing, while it can also make a more beautiful inner box.
  • the two outwardly protruding buckles 20 oppositely deform inwards under external force so as to force the outwardly protruding buckles 20 to be separated from the buckle holes 11 and to push out the paper pulp inner box 2.
  • the outwardly protruding buckles 20 are buckled in the buckle holes 11 so as to achieve the mutual locking of the paper pulp outer box and the paper pulp inner box, which prevents infants from opening the paper pulp inner box by mistake and eating the food or medicine in the paper pulp inner box.
  • the buckle hole 11 provided on one side edge of the paper pulp outer box 1 and the buckle hole 11 provided on the other side edge of the paper pulp outer box 1 are staggered in front and back;
  • the outwardly protruding buckle 20 provided on one side edge of the paper pulp outer box 1 and the outwardly protruding buckle 20 provided on the other side edge of the paper pulp outer box 1 are staggered in front and back.
  • the outwardly protruding buckles 20 become buckled in the buckle holes 11.
  • Distributed dislocations may form multiple opening-blocking effects, including the outwardly protruding buckles having asymmetrically positioned left and right sides, and the outwardly protruding buckles 20 having edges that make the outwardly protruding buckles 20 easily pushed in and prevented from being pulled out.
  • outwardly protruding buckles on the left and right sides are not arranged along a straight line and are specially arranged with a relatively long distance. An infant's hands are small, which makes it difficult for them to press the outwardly protruding buckles as the same time, thus preventing it from being pulled out by infant.
  • the outwardly protruding buckles 20 are inwardly inclined from the upper opening to the bottom of the paper pulp inner box 2, and an inclined groove 21 with an inclined direction consistent with that of the outwardly protruding buckle 20 is formed on the inner side of the outwardly protruding buckle 20.
  • the design of the inclined groove can achieve the release of deformation pressure and freely rebound after release, while the inclined outwardly protruding buckles 20 facilitate pressing inward to quickly extract the paper pulp inner box.
  • the upper end of the outwardly protruding buckles 20 protrudes out of the outer opening of the buckle hole 11, and the upper end of the inclined groove 21 communicates with the outside.
  • Such structure may achieve locking and avoid free shedding.
  • the communication with the outside can achieve air communication between the inside and the outside, which may prevent the formation of a seal that makes it difficult to withdraw the paper pulp inner box.
  • the gap can also prevent the formation of a seal that makes it difficult to pull out the paper pulp inner box.
  • the outwardly protruding buckle 20 includes an outer convex side edge part I 201 close to one end of the inner box inlet and outlet opening 10.
  • An angle I equal to 90° is formed between an outer surface of the outwardly protruding side edge part I (201) and the side edge of the paper pulp inner box (2).
  • the angle I facilitates the locking of the outwardly protruding side edge part I 201 on the hole wall of the buckle hole, because the outer surface of the outwardly protruding side edge part I 201 matches with the hole wall surface of the buckle hole, that is, achieves locking.
  • An out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 is away from the outwardly protruding side edge part I 201.
  • An angle II greater than 90° is formed between an outer surface of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 and the side edge of the paper pulp inner box 2.
  • the angle II is greater than 90° and smaller than 180°.
  • the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 is at such an angle that facilitates the insertion of the paper pulp inner box into the paper pulp outer box, that is, the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 serves as a guide during insertion.
  • the width of the outwardly protruding side edge part I 201 gradually decreases from the upper opening to the bottom of the paper pulp inner box 2, and the width of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 gradually decreases from the upper opening to the bottom of the paper pulp inner box 2.
  • This width structure of the design improves the structural strength of the outwardly protruding buckles without compromising the deformability of the outwardly protruding buckles.
  • the above-mentioned structure not only realizes the function of self-locking, but also reduces the contact area between the outwardly protruding side edge part I 201 and the corresponding hole wall of the buckle hole. The main effect of reducing the contact area is to facilitate pull out of the paper pulp inner box later.
  • the width of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 gradually decreases from the upper opening to the bottom of the paper pulp inner box 2, and a line of contact is formed between corresponding hole wall of the buckle hole and the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202, which facilitates pulling out the paper pulp inner box from the paper pulp outer box.
  • the outwardly protruding buckles further include inclined parts 203, with one side edge of the inclined part 203 connected to one side edge of the outwardly protruding side edge part I 201 which is away from the paper pulp inner box 2, and the other side edge of the inclined part 203 connected to one side edge of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 which is away from the paper pulp inner box 2.
  • the bottom side of the inclined part 203 is connected to the bottom side edge of the paper pulp inner box 2 to form the above-mentioned inclined groove 21, and the groove depth of the inclined groove 21 gradually decreases from the side of the outwardly protruding side edge part I 201 to the side of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202.
  • the unequal depth design of the groove depth facilitates the release deformation and supports structural strength during the deformation process, that is, the deformation of the outwardly protruding side edge part I 201 is the largest, and the deformation of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 is less than that of the outwardly protruding side edge part 1201.
  • the depth of the inclined groove 21 is designed to facilitate the insertion of the paper pulp inner box into the paper pulp outer box to achieve quick assembly.
  • the outer surface of the inclined part 203 is an arc-shaped concave surface, and the inner surface of the inclined part 203 is an arc-shaped convex surface.
  • An angle III smaller than 90° is formed between an inner surface of the outwardly protruding side edge part I 201 and an inner surface of the inclined part 203, and an angle IV greater than 90° is formed between an inner surface of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 and the inner surface of the inclined part 203.
  • the design of the angles facilitates deformation and also facilitates restoration after deformation.
  • a closed portion 12 is arranged at one end of the paper pulp outer box 1 which is away from the inner box inlet and outlet opening 10, and an inner box ejection hole 13 is arranged on the closed portion 12 which facilitates push out of the paper pulp inner box.
  • the closed portion 12 may limit the position of the paper pulp inner box after insertion.
  • the buckle holes 11 are square holes, and outer surface of the outwardly protruding side edge part I 201 matches with the corresponding hole wall surface of the square hole.
  • An angle II between 120° and 170° is formed between the outer surface of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 and the side edge of the paper pulp inner box 2, and outer surface of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 is in line contact with the corresponding hole wall surface of the square hole.
  • the paper pulp inner box and the paper pulp outer box are set in a tightly fitted state.
  • the outwardly protruding buckles on the paper pulp inner box protrude outward, which will naturally form a tight and difficult to move state with the paper pulp outer box. Even if the outwardly protruding buckles on the left and right sides are pressed in at the same time, the paper pulp inner box can be pushed out only with the help of fingers that push out the paper pulp inner box through the ejection hole at the rear end.
  • the transverse section of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 is arc-shaped, an outer surface of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 is an arc-shaped convex surface, and the inner surface of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 is an arc-shaped concave surface, and the arc-shaped concave surface and the arc-shaped convex surface match each other.
  • One side edge of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 is connected to one side edge of the inclined part, and the other side edge of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 is connected to the paper pulp inner box 2 through an arc-shaped inner concave part 22.
  • the design of the arc-shaped inner concave part 22 facilitates the insertion of the paper pulp inner box into the paper pulp outer box and extraction of the paper pulp inner box.
  • the directions of the outwardly protruding side edge part II 202 and the arc-shaped inner concave part 22 are different, and they are connected with each other, which can realize deformation and elastic deformation restoration during the pressing process.
  • the paper pulp inner box 2 and the outwardly protruding buckles 20 are integrally formed by paper pulp pressing.
  • the paper pulp inner box 2 is manufactured by a paper pulp inner box mold.
  • the paper pulp outer box 1 is manufactured by a paper pulp outer box mold.
  • the inner part of the paper pulp inner box 2 is provided with an inner arc chamfer 23, and the outer bottom of the paper pulp inner box 2 is provided with an outer arc chamfer 24 which is concentric with the inner arc chamfer 23.
  • the outer arc chamfer 24 facilitates the insertion of the paper pulp inner box into the paper pulp outer box, while the design of the inner arc chamfer 23 facilitates the processing and manufacture of the paper pulp inner box 2.
